How to conjugate desviar in Subjunctive Imperfect in Spanish

desviar
to divert, to deflect, to stray
regular verb

Desviar means to turn aside, divert, or cause something to change direction. It can be used physically, such as diverting a road, or metaphorically, such as diverting attention.

How to conjugate desviar in Subjunctive Imperfect

El Imperfecto Subjuntivo - used to speak about unlikely or uncertain events in the past
